About SocialSelf

SocialSelf's mission is to help people build fulfilling, happy, and healthy social lives. We work together with psychologists, doctors, and scientists to provide actionable and accurate psychological information. We offer a range of courses focused on topics such as social skills, friendship, social anxiety, conversation skills, relationships, confidence, charisma, and more.
